Biography of Bump J
Bump J, born Terrance Boykin, is a Chicago-born rapper known for his raw and honest portrayal of life in the city's streets. His music captures the essence of Chicago's hip-hop scene, blending gritty realism with an undeniable talent for storytelling. Bump J's journey in the music industry is marked by both his early promise and the challenges he faced along the way. Despite encountering significant obstacles, his resilience and passion for music have remained unwavering, allowing him to make a lasting impact on the genre.
The table below provides a snapshot of Bump J's personal details:
Full Name | Terrance Boykin |
---|---|
Stage Name | Bump J |
Date of Birth | October 15, 1980 |
Place of Birth | Chicago, Illinois, USA |
Genres | Hip-Hop, Rap |
Years Active | 2003 - Present |
Labels | Goon Squad, Atlantic Records |

Musical Beginnings and Breakthrough
Bump J's journey into the music industry began in the early 2000s when he started performing at local venues and honing his craft. His undeniable talent and unique style quickly caught the attention of influential figures within the industry, paving the way for his breakthrough moment. Bump J's authenticity and lyrical prowess set him apart from other emerging artists, earning him a dedicated following and critical acclaim.
In 2005, Bump J released his debut single "Move Around," which became an instant hit in Chicago and beyond. The track showcased his ability to blend catchy hooks with hard-hitting lyrics, capturing the attention of fans and industry insiders alike. This success marked a turning point in Bump J's career, solidifying his status as a rising star within the hip-hop community.
Following the success of "Move Around," Bump J signed a record deal with Atlantic Records, further cementing his position in the music industry. This partnership provided him with the resources and platform needed to reach a wider audience, allowing him to share his music and message with fans across the globe.

Legal Troubles and Imprisonment
Despite his promising career, Bump J faced significant challenges that threatened to derail his success. In 2008, he was arrested and charged with bank robbery, a crime that ultimately led to a lengthy prison sentence. This unexpected turn of events marked a difficult period in Bump J's life, as he grappled with the consequences of his actions and the impact on his career.
